Neural networks are revolutionizing the field of machine translation by providing more accurate and context-aware translations. In this article, we'll delve into the world of neural networks and explore they operate in translation.
At its core, a neural network is a complex system consisting of multiple layers of neurons. Each neuron receives inputs from previous layers, performs a computation, and then passes the output to the next layer. This process continues until the final output is produced.
In the context of translation, neural networks are trained on significant amounts of text in the source and 有道翻译 target languages. The network develops the ability to detect relationships between words and phrases in the input text, which enables it to generate more precise and natural translations.
There are two primary types of neural networks used in translation: seq2seq models and encoder-decoder model designs. Seq2seq models consist of an encoder and a decoder network. The encoder takes the input text and condenses into a fixed-size vector, which is then transmitted to the decoder. The decoder produces the translated text one token at a time, using the encoded vector as a reference.
Encoder-decoder approaches, on the other hand, have two separate networks: an encoder and a decoder. The encoder processes the input and generates a vector that represents the input, while the decoder processes the encoded information and produces the translated text. The key difference between seq2seq and encoder-decoder approaches is that encoder-decoder models allow for more flexibility and management over the translation process.
One of the significant advantages of neural networks in translation is their ability to cope with nuances and complexities. Traditional statistical machine translation (SMT) models rely on lexical examination, which can result in inaccuracies in cases where words are polysemous or are contextually dependent. Neural networks, with their capacity to identify connections and correlations, can better handle these complexities and generate more accurate translations.
Neural network-based approaches also have the capacity to learn and adapt to specific domains and styles. This is particularly beneficial for scenarios such as technical translation, where vocabulary and terminology may be specific to a particular industry or domain. By training the model on large datasets of technical text, the neural network can acquire the ability to translate domain-specific terminology and vocabulary with a high degree of accuracy.
In conclusion, neural networks are revolutionizing the field of machine translation by providing more accurate and context-aware translations. Their ability to cope with nuances and complexities, as well as acquire knowledge of particular topics and linguistic styles, makes them a key player in the world of translation. As the field continues to evolve, it's likely that neural networks will play an increasingly important role in shaping the trajectory of language translation.